| + | ===== Discussion ===== | ||
| + | |||
| + | Logical Node Responsibility describes the obligation, function, or accountability associated with a Logical Node or Logical Node Role. | ||
| + | |||
| + | Logical Node Roles identify categories of responsibility. Logical Node Responsibilities describe the specific responsibilities that a Logical Node carries within the logical architecture. Examples of responsibilities include producing, consuming, and validating information; | ||
| + | |||
| + | Logical Node Responsibilities help reviewers understand why a Logical Node exists, which interactions it participates in, which information structures it handles, and which evidence expectations apply to it. | ||

| + | ===== Example ===== | ||
| + | |||
| + | A logical validation Node carries responsibility for receiving candidate transaction records, applying validation logic, publishing validation results, and recording provenance for each validation outcome. | ||
